KHA Testifies on Freestanding Birthing Centers

Today, KHA President Nancy Galvagni testified alongside Dr. Dan Goulson, chair of KHA’s Physician Leadership Forum and the chief medical officer at CHI Saint Joseph Health and St. Elizabeth Healthcare obstetrician Dr. Allana Oak at the Interim Joint Committee on Licensing, Occupations, & Administrative Regulations meeting addressing certificate of need (CON) requirements for freestanding birthing centers.

Galvagni, Goulson, and Oak all stressed the health and safety of mothers and their babies and noted hospitals are best equipped to handle the unpredictability of childbirth. The team reiterated KHA’s stance that freestanding birthing centers should not be removed from CON and the facilities should have transfer agreements with hospitals and operate under the direction of a licensed OBGYN.
